Saudi: Benzema May Leave Al-Ittihad For League Leaders Al-HilalStriker Karim Benzema has opened negotiations to join Saudi Pro League leaders Al-Hilal amid an ongoing dispute with his current club, Al-Ittihad. Naija News understands that discussions are currently ongoing between the parties over a possible move for the remainder of the season. “Negotiations are underway between the parties: Al-Hilal would like to sign Benzema […]
